Output ec4152b364eff8cb69d9a2f85158b994cf665a189c5c56f410135fb28be46214:208

value
348579520
script pubkey
OP_0 OP_PUSHBYTES_20 f1e55e6d59bf4d408bf6dc70e9e7e34db945fcf2
address
bc1q78j4um2ehax5pzlkm3cwnelrfku5tl8jtqu0jj
transaction
ec4152b364eff8cb69d9a2f85158b994cf665a189c5c56f410135fb28be46214
spent
true